What is Amazon FSx for NetApp ONTAP?

Amazon FSx for NetApp ONTAP is a fully managed, multiprotocol storage service in the AWS Cloud with the proven management capabilities of NetApp ONTAP for easier workload migration and operation. It combines the familiar ONTAP capabilities and APIs with the agility, scalability, and simplicity of a fully managed AWS service.

FSx for ONTAP helps organizations migrate and run enterprise workloads in AWS while supporting a broad range of use cases — including VMware-based workloads and relational databases — by providing high-performance shared storage accessible via industry-standard protocols such as NFS, SMB, iSCSI, NVMe/TCP, and S3 object protocols.

For performance-sensitive workloads such as VMware and databases, FSx for ONTAP delivers consistent, high throughput and sub-millisecond latencies with SSD storage. It also allows customers to scale storage performance and capacity independently from compute resources, enabling a flexible architecture and helping right-size resources without overprovisioning.

The FSx for ONTAP Advantage: How It Actually Generates Savings

FSx for ONTAP brings the enterprise-grade data management capabilities of ONTAP to a fully managed AWS service. But beyond performance and familiarity, FSx for ONTAP is fundamentally designed to shrink storage footprints and drastically reduce monthly cloud bills.

Here is exactly how FSx for ONTAP actively generates those savings:

  • Advanced Storage Efficiencies: FSx for ONTAP natively utilizes data deduplication, compression, and compaction. By eliminating redundant data blocks and compressing the rest at the storage layer, organizations routinely see up to 65% storage capacity savings for general-purpose workloads.
  • Elastic Capacity Pool Tiering: Not all data needs to reside on expensive, high-performance SSDs. FSx for ONTAP automatically monitors access patterns and seamlessly tiers inactive or “cold” data to a lower-cost capacity pool. You only pay SSD rates for the active or “hot” fraction of your data, while the bulk of your growing dataset scales on highly economical storage.
  • Thin Provisioning: With FSx for ONTAP, volumes only consume storage capacity for the actual data written, rather than the total volume size allocated. This eliminates the financial penalty of over-provisioning storage up front just to be safe.
  • Built-in Data Management: FSx for ONTAP also provides snapshots, cloning, and cross-region replication technology that supports robust data migration, disaster recovery, and speeds up Dev/Test workflows — all with the click of a button.
  • Decreasing SSD storage capacity: With FSx for ONTAP, you can scale down storage capacity, right-sizing post-deployment within a highly available production-ready system. The impact extends beyond simple capacity management, allowing organizations running data-intensive, project-based workloads to optimize costs and improve resource efficiency by eliminating the need to overprovision for peak demand periods.

Why “Drive-Level” Recommendations Matters

Until now, mapping legacy infrastructure to advanced cloud storage often required broad assumptions. By bringing FSx for ONTAP recommendations down to the drive level, Cloudamize eliminates the guesswork.

Instead of looking at a server’s total storage in aggregate, Cloudamize evaluates the unique performance profiles, IOPS, and utilization metrics of each individual drive. This means you can confidently recommend FSx for ONTAP for the specific drives that will benefit most from deduplication and auto-tiering, while routing other drives to standard Amazon EBS volumes if that proves more cost-effective.

By integrating FSx for ONTAP in the Cloudamize assessment, customers gain deeper visibility into how different storage services align with their workload requirements, enabling more informed decisions and greater confidence in selecting the right storage architecture for their AWS migration. Precision at this granular level ensures that every gigabyte is optimized before the migration even begins.

This level of granularity is especially valuable for projects such as Re-Host from VMware into native Amazon EC2, where storage was previously mapped at the server level. With drive-level visibility, Cloudamize can now distinguish between the individual drives attached to each VM, recommending FSx for ONTAP only where it delivers the most value and routing the rest to lower-cost alternatives where appropriate. The result is a more cost-optimized option in the assessment, rather than a single broad-brush recommendation applied uniformly across every drive on the server.
